While previous versions of roadway lighting standards often focused heavily on the amount of light hitting the pavement (illuminance), RP-8-18 marked a significant paradigm shift. It solidified the industry's move toward , prioritizing how well a driver can actually see objects on the road, rather than just how bright the road appears.
